Pada artikel selanjutnya kita akan melihat Awesome finder. Seorang pengguna GitHub telah membuat file utilitas untuk terminal yang dengannya kita dapat menemukan proyek dan sumber daya yang mengesankan di repositori GitHub. Utilitas ini membantu kami menavigasi daftar yang dapat kami temukan di portal itu tanpa meninggalkan terminal.
Ratusan proyek baru ditambahkan ke situs web GitHub setiap hari. Sejak GitHub Ini memiliki ribuan hal, jika Anda adalah pengguna biasa situs web ini, Anda akan tahu bahwa Anda bisa kelelahan ketika Anda mencari proyek yang bagus. Untungnya, banyak kontributor telah membuat daftar bagus berisi hal-hal keren yang dihosting di GitHub. Daftar ini berisi banyak proyek mengagumkan yang dikelompokkan dalam kategori berbedaseperti: pemrograman, database, editor, game, hiburan dan banyak lagi. Daftar ini membuat hidup kita jauh lebih mudah ketika harus menemukan proyek, perangkat lunak, sumber daya, perpustakaan, buku, dan semua hal lain yang dihosting di GitHub.
Instal finder yang luar biasa
Kami akan menjadi pencari yang luar biasa instal dengan mudah menggunakan pip. Ini adalah manajer paket untuk menginstal program yang dikembangkan dalam bahasa pemrograman Python. Di Debian, Ubuntu, Linux Mint kita dapat menginstal manajer paket ini dengan mengetik di terminal (Ctrl + Alt + T) berikut ini:
sudo apt-get install python-pip
Menurut pengembangnya di halaman GitHub proyek, saat ini kami hanya dapat menggunakan aplikasi ini jika ada Python 3 atau lebih tinggi. Untuk menginstal aplikasi ini sekarang kita harus mengetik di terminal:
sudo pip install awesome-finder
Jika kita gunakan di sistem Ubuntu kita Python 2.7.X. Kita bisa menjalankan program menggunakan pip3, seperti yang saya tunjukkan di bawah ini:
sudo pip3 install awesome-finder
Menggunakan finder yang luar biasa
Cara menggunakan aplikasi ini sangat sederhana. Penemu yang luar biasa hari ini daftar topik berikut, yang merupakan repositori, tentu saja dari situs GitHub:
- mengagumkan
- mengagumkan-android
- obat mujarab yang mengagumkan
- luar biasa-pergi
- mengagumkan-ios
- mengagumkan-java
- javascript-mengagumkan
- mengagumkan-php
- mengagumkan-python
- mengagumkan-ruby
- karat yang luar biasa
- keren-scala
- luar biasa-cepat
Selalu menurut pengembangnya, daftar ini akan diperbarui secara berkala, jadi tinggal menunggu waktu sebelum diperluas (saya harap begitu).
Misalnya, untuk melihat daftar repositori javascript-mengagumkan, kita hanya perlu mengetik di terminal:
awesome javascript
Anda akan melihat daftar proyek yang berhubungan dengan «javascript». Mereka akan muncul dalam urutan abjad. Kita akan bisa navigasikan daftar menggunakan panah ATAS / BAWAH. Ketika kami menemukan apa yang kami cari, kami akan menempatkan diri kami di atas dan kami harus menekan tombolnya MASUK untuk membuka tautan di browser web default kami.
Contoh finder yang lebih keren
- Dengan "android yang luar biasa » kami akan mencari repositori android-mengagumkan.
- Jika kami menggunakan «keren keren " kami akan mencari repositori yang luar biasa.
- Gunakan "ramuan mengagumkan » akan mencari repositori elixir-mengagumkan.
- "Luar biasa" akan mencari repositori awesome-go.
- Gunakan "Ios yang luar biasa" akan mencari repositori ios yang mengagumkan.
- Menggunakan «java yang luar biasa » kita akan mencari repositori java-mengagumkan.
- Jika kami menggunakan «javascript mengagumkan » Kami akan mencari repositori javascript-mengagumkan.
- Dengan "php luar biasa » kami akan mencari repositori php-mengagumkan.
- Jika kita memilih «python yang mengagumkan » kita akan mencari repositori awesome-python.
- "Ruby yang luar biasa" akan mencari repositori ruby-mengagumkan.
- Ketika menggunakan "karat yang luar biasa » akan mencari repositori karat-mengagumkan.
- Kami juga akan memiliki opsi untuk menggunakan «scala yang mengagumkan » kami akan mencari repositori scala-mengagumkan.
- Dengan "kecepatan luar biasa » Kami akan mencari repositori keren-cepat.
Selain itu, kami akan melakukannya secara otomatis menampilkan saran saat mengetik di indikator. Sebagai contoh, ketika saya mengetik "dj", ini memperlihatkan elemen yang berhubungan dengan Django.
Jika yang kita inginkan adalah menemukan hal terakhir yang ditambahkan, tanpa menggunakan cache, kita hanya perlu menggunakan opsi -fo –force seperti yang ditunjukkan di bawah ini:
awesome -f (--force)
Contoh:
awesome python -f
atau Anda juga bisa menggunakan:
awesome python --force
Perintah di atas akan mencantumkan proyek terbaru yang ditambahkan yang terkait dengan Python.
Saat kami menelusuri daftar, kami bisa keluar dari utilitas dengan menekan tombol ESC.
Jika kita perlu melihat bantuan program, kita bisa berkonsultasi dengan mengetik di konsol berikut ini:
awesome -h
Kita dapat mempelajari lebih lanjut tentang proyek ini dan kodenya di halaman GitHub tentang itu
Copot pemasangan finder yang luar biasa
Untuk menghilangkan program ini dari sistem operasi kami, kami hanya perlu menulis perintah berikut di terminal (Ctrl + Alt + T):
sudo pip uninstall awesome-finder
Terima kasih telah membagikan informasi yang bagus. Saya ingin tahu lebih banyak tentang apa yang baru dan saya pikir kita harus selalu belajar dari satu sama lain